Lady Loboes Wrestle Coronado
   
by Jessica Ray, Staff Writer ~~ The Monahans News, September 21, 2007


After falling in three games to Coronado in a Saturday dual, the Lady Loboes brought the Mustangs to the home court. Monahans still did not end the night with the match win, but was far from empty handed. The Ladies put up strong resistance and were able to come away with a game win, this time pushing Coronado into four games.

Coronado took the first game fairly quickly 15-25. In game two, the Green just could not get within two points of the Lady Mustangs, falling 18-25.

Heather Schulz (15) got game three off to a good start with an ace. Monahans kept scoring until the fourth pint, and continued to fend off the Mustangs, who were eventually able to tie with the ladies at 11.

Bailey Marcum (23) lost a contact lens on the court after the next serve, which brought the game to a short halt. When she returned , the battle became fiercer than it had been all night, and soon tied at 16.

Monahans and Coronado battled for one-point leads  for the remainder of  the game, but when Monahans was at a 26-25 advantage, Marcum finished the game off with an ace.

The confidence of the game-three win was not enough to carry the team through game four.

Twice, the Mustangs were able to get an eight-point lead over the Ladies, but Monahans made an impressive rally and sneaked up to just one point behind Coronado, 22-23.

The comeback was enough to bring the crowds to their feet when Coronado called a time out, but a Mustang kill gave Coronado the two-point lead they needed, and when a Lady Lobo kill when out of bounds, the game ended 22-25.

Marcum made a shining 10 kills,10 digs and five blocks. She also served three aces.

Schulz also served three aces for the night. Schulz had seven kills, eight digs and a block.

Kaitlin Mitchell (12) had 20 assists, four kills and two digs.

Jordan Latham (20) served up two aces, 11 digs, two blocks and one kill.

Kati Holly (5) had three kills, one assist, two blocks, five digs and an ace.

Kristi Holly (21) had three digs, a block and a kill.

Candace Cutbirth (10) contributed eight digs, while Senior Kristi Wilson (4) had one.

The Varsity now has a 22-9 record.
